Two elephants, named Shirley and Jenny, met more than 20 years ago when they were both involved in a circus. Shirley was in her 20s and Jenny was just a baby, but nevertheless, the two bonded like great friends with the love that a mother would have for her child. But after a few years together, the pair were separated from each other without the possibility of reuniting, until it was arranged for them both to be transported to The Elephant Sanctuary in Tennessee.

The two elephants were introduced to each other once again with bars between them. The workers at the sanctuary and others involved were skeptical at first, they did not know how the two animals would react. But as the pair walked closer to one another, they miraculously recognized each other and began embracing in happiness. They even began to bend the bars between them in order to get closer. It was a sight that was beautiful and touching and luckily caught on camera.
